Here’s a power cable from a Cmt-ex1 Sony CD player. This connector used to be connected to the inside of the power supply. However, I had to disassemble it because I needed to replace the motherboard for the CD player. I found this CD player at Goodwill, but the wire was poorly connected with a completely different cable. It was patched together using electrical tape and wire connectors. If there isn’t any type of connector like this in the world. how could I Frankenstein it with another cable without it looking somewhat ugly.\n
\n
The original cable was called E81093 (UL) NISPT-2 VW-1 105C 2X18AWG, C(UL) NONINTEGRAL SPT-2 FT1. Also the yellow plastic says Amp with a + on top of the M. this CD player is from 2000.
